Decoding the Digital Reel: How Modern Spins Work

Decoding the Digital Reel: How Modern Spins Work centers on the Random Number Generator (RNG), a software algorithm that continuously generates thousands of number sequences per second. When you click spin, the RNG instantly captures that exact microsecond’s sequence, which maps to a specific combination of symbols on a virtual reel strip. This means each spin is an independent, unpredictable event, with no connection to past or future spins.

The visual spinning reel is purely an animation layered over the RNG’s predetermined result, already finalized the moment you press spin.

Modern slots map these numbers to weighted symbol sets, meaning higher-paying symbols appear less frequently, which defines the game’s payout probability entirely behind the digital interface.

Return to Player Rates: What the Percentages Mean

The Return to Player (RTP) Rate is a theoretical percentage representing the long-term average payout slots not on gamstop a slot returns to players over millions of spins. For example, a 96% RTP means the game mathematically returns $96 for every $100 wagered, though individual sessions can vary wildly. A higher RTP, like 98%, reduces the house edge, preserving your bankroll longer than a low 88% game. This percentage does not apply to short sessions; it is a statistical forecast, not a guarantee of wins. Always check a slot’s RTP in its info screen before playing, as this figure directly impacts your expected value over extended play.

Volatility Explained: Low, Medium, and High Risk Gameplay

Volatility is the heartbeat of your slot session, dictating how often and how big you win. Low volatility gameplay offers frequent, small payouts—perfect for stretching your bankroll. Medium volatility strikes a balance, mixing occasional modest hits with a few bigger wins. High volatility is the thrill-seeker’s path: you’ll endure dry spells, but when a win hits, it can be massive. Choosing your volatility is less about luck and more about matching the ride to your risk comfort.

Volatility Level Win Frequency Win Size Best For
Low Very frequent Small Long, steady play sessions
Medium Moderate Mixed small & medium Balanced entertainment
High Infrequent Large to massive Chasing big jackpots

Paylines, Ways to Win, and Megaways Structures

Paylines define fixed patterns across reels where matching symbols must land for a payout, typically ranging from 10 to 243 lines. In contrast, Ways to Win structures eliminate paylines by rewarding any adjacent symbols from left to right, offering thousands of potential combinations. Megaways systems dynamically shift reel heights per spin, creating up to 117,649 ways through variable symbol positions. Selecting between these models directly alters volatility and win frequency, as fixed paylines offer predictable outcomes while Megaways introduces higher variance.

  • Paylines require bets per line and only pay along predetermined paths, limiting flexibility.
  • Ways to Win pay for all matching adjacent symbols, often raising hit frequency without extra cost per spin.
  • Megaways change reel sizes each spin, exponentially increasing ways but requiring careful bankroll management due to unpredictability.

Progressive Jackpots vs. Fixed Jackpots

When choosing your next game, the core distinction lies in how the prize pool grows. Progressive jackpots vs. fixed jackpots determines risk versus reward. Fixed jackpots offer a set, guaranteed payout regardless of how many players spin; you know exactly what you are playing for. Progressive jackpots, however, accumulate a small portion of every bet across a network, creating life-changing sums that keep climbing until one lucky spin resets them. While progressives promise massive upside, their long-shot odds mean you will likely spin through your bankroll faster than chasing a fixed prize. A fixed jackpot provides consistent, predictable play, whereas a progressive is a lottery-style chase for a single, massive win.

Choose a fixed jackpot for reliable, attainable wins; choose a progressive jackpot for a shot at a life-altering, but statistically rare, payout.

Understanding Wagering Requirements

online slots

Understanding wagering requirements is essential to avoid overspending on online slots. These requirements specify how many times you must play through a bonus amount (often 30x to 50x) before withdrawing any winnings. A common trap is assuming a free spins win is yours immediately; only after meeting the playthrough does it become cash. High wagering requirements can erase slot wins quickly if you have a limited bankroll. Always check the requirement and game contribution percentages before claiming an offer.

Q: How do wagering requirements affect my slot play?
A: They force you to bet a set multiple of the bonus, often making it difficult to profit unless you win consistently within that cycle.

Audio Cues That Influence Player Behavior

In online slots, audio cues that influence player behavior are meticulously designed to manipulate perception and prolong engagement. A celebratory fanfare upon a modest win creates a false sense of accomplishment, encouraging continued spins. Conversely, near-miss sound effects, such as a triumphant chord cut short, exploit cognitive biases, convincing the player they were close to a jackpot. Tempo and pitch shifts during bonus rounds elevate arousal, making loss-chasing feel urgent. Finally, the absence of sound during non-winning spins subtly fades those moments from memory, reinforcing the desire to hear rewarding audio again.

Licensing Authorities and Jurisdictional Differences

Different licensing authorities, such as the UK Gambling Commission or the Malta Gaming Authority, enforce distinct rules for jurisdictional differences in slot fairness. A game certified in one region might have varying payout percentages or feature restrictions elsewhere. This affects player recourse; disputes handled under a strict license offer clearer protection than those in lightly regulated markets. Always check the footer of a casino site to identify its specific authority.

Does the licensing authority affect my ability to withdraw winnings? Yes, jurisdictional differences mean terms like withdrawal limits or identity verification procedures can vary significantly. A license from a reputable authority usually ensures more transparent, enforceable payout policies.
